How to Fix a Loose Banister Safely and Permanently

A wobbly banister isn’t just annoying—it’s a safety hazard. If your handrail shifts more than 1/4 inch when pressed, it fails the International Residential Code (IRC R311.7.8) deflection standard and needs immediate attention. Most loose banisters stem from simple fastener failure—not structural collapse—but ignoring them invites injury or failed home inspections.

Quick Diagnosis

Before grabbing tools, identify the root cause:

  • Loose lag screws or bolts at wall or newel post connections
  • Rotted or split wood where the rail attaches to the post or wall
  • Worn-out mounting brackets or missing washers
  • Shrinkage or seasonal movement in hardwood posts (common in homes over 10 years old)
  • Missing or corroded anchor bolts in concrete or masonry walls

Step-by-Step Fix

Choose the method that matches your diagnosis:

  1. Tighten existing fasteners: Use a torque-controlled driver or wrench to snug—don’t overtighten—lag bolts at both ends of the rail. Check deflection again; if movement remains, proceed.
  2. Reinforce stripped holes: Remove old screws, drill out damaged wood to 3/8", inject epoxy wood filler, insert threaded inserts or dowels, then reinstall screws after 2 hours cure time.
  3. Add hidden support brackets: Mount 90° steel brackets (like Simpson Strong-Tie HSS series) between rail underside and wall stud or newel post. Conceal with matching wood caps.
  4. Replace rotted sections: Cut out compromised wood using a flush-cut saw, glue and clamp a new hardwood block (same species and grain orientation), then re-drill and bolt.

When to Call a Pro

Stop and consult a licensed contractor or structural engineer if:

  • The newel post rocks side-to-side more than 1/2 inch at the base
  • You find termite damage, fungal decay, or water staining under trim
  • The banister is attached to a non-load-bearing wall with no visible studs behind drywall
  • Your home was built before 1990 and uses balloon framing with inaccessible anchor points

Prevention Tips

Maintain stability year-round with these habits:

  • Inspect all railing connections twice yearly—especially after winter humidity swings
  • Apply clear silicone caulk around base plates to block moisture intrusion
  • Replace zinc-plated screws with stainless steel or hot-dipped galvanized hardware every 7–10 years
  • Use a torque wrench set to 45–55 ft-lbs on lag bolts—over-torquing splits wood faster than under-torquing loosens it

Can I use regular wood glue instead of epoxy filler?

No. Standard PVA glue lacks shear strength for vertical load paths. Epoxy wood fillers like Abatron WoodEpox or System Three Quick Cure resist compression and vibration better—and pass ASTM D2559 testing for structural wood repair. Skip the shortcut.

Do I need a permit to repair my banister?

Most jurisdictions exempt cosmetic or maintenance repairs—but if you replace the entire rail assembly, add new posts, or alter height or spacing, a permit is required. Why does my banister loosen every spring?

Seasonal humidity changes cause wood to swell and shrink, gradually working screws loose—especially in pine or poplar rails. Combat this by pre-drilling oversized pilot holes (1/16" larger than screw shank), using helical ring-shank screws, and applying a thin bead of construction adhesive (e.g., PL Premium) beneath mounting plates.

Can I reinforce a metal banister the same way?

No. Metal railings rely on welded joints or high-strength through-bolts. If a stainless steel or aluminum rail is loose, inspect for cracked welds or bent mounting flanges. What’s the fastest temporary fix until I get tools?

Insert wooden toothpicks dipped in wood glue into stripped screw holes, break off flush, let dry 1 hour, then reinsert original screws. It’s not code-compliant long-term but holds 150+ lbs for up to 3 weeks—enough time to order proper epoxy and hardware. Don’t rely on it near stairs used by children or seniors.
